    Fuel Your Creative Passion
    The Canon EOS 7D Mark II digital SLR camera is designed to meet the demands of photographers and videographers who want a camera that can provide a wide range of artistic opportunities. With a winning combination of cutting-edge operations and a robust, ergonomic design, it is optimized to make even the most challenging photography simple and easy. The EOS 7D Mark II features a refined APS-C sized 20.2 Megapixel CMOS sensor with Dual DIGIC 6 Image Processors for gorgeous imagery. It shoots up to 10 frames per second at ISOs ranging from 100–16000 (expandable to H1: 25600, H2: 51200), has a 65-point all cross-type AF system and features Canon’s amazing Dual Pixel CMOS AF for brilliant Live-View AF. It has dual card slots for both CF and SD cards, USB 3.0 connectivity and even has built-in GPS for easy location tagging, automatically. Compatible with an ever-expanding collection of EF and EF-S lenses plus a host of EOS accessories, the EOS 7D Mark II is an ideal tool for creative and ambitious photography.

    Up to 10.0 fps Continuous Shooting
    A new, rugged shutter designed for 200,000 cycles, enables the EOS 7D Mark II to shoot up to 10.0 frames per second to capture all the action. Refined mechanics like a newly designed, more efficient shutter drive motor and a vibration dampened mirror drive help deliver reliable, speedy performance for high caliber image capture.

    AF System to Match
    The EOS 7D Mark II features some of Canon’s most sophisticated AF technologies ever, enabling the camera to achieve accurate and speedy AF performance while maintaining impeccably clear action shots. Designed to be fast, the EOS 7D Mark II delivers impressive results.

    Dual Pixel CMOS AF
    Canon’s revolutionary Dual Pixel CMOS AF enables superb HD shooting with the EOS 7D Mark II. With Dual Pixel CMOS AF, each pixel on the camera’s sensor performs both phase-difference detection autofocus and records light. Auto-focus is achieved quickly, easily and smoothly thanks to phase-difference detection AF. When used with the predictive power of Movie Servo AF, subjects in motion are smoothly and consistently tracked –once focus is locked, the EOS 7D Mark II stays on target!

    65-point All Cross-type AF System
    The advanced 65-point all cross-type AF system helps ensure precise and stable AF no matter the subject or camera’s orientation. These AF points are spread over a wide area of the frame, enabling faster AF wherever the subject lies. With a central dual cross-type AF point of f/2.8, AF is enhanced with lenses faster than f/2.8. Also, this new system makes AF possible in dim lighting as low as EV-3.

    20.2 Megapixel CMOS Sensor
    A brand new 20.2 Megapixel sensor helps record high resolution image files with stunning detail. Redesigned specifically for the EOS 7D Mark II, this impressive sensor captures a new level of clarity with low noise and high sensitivity. Phenomenal for stills, the camera’s sensor is equally impressive for movies, offering Canon’s revolutionary Dual Pixel CMOS AF for impressive and smooth AF performance.

    Dual DIGIC 6 Image Processors
    The Dual DIGIC 6 Image Processors work seamlessly with the new 20.2 Megapixel sensor for supercharged processing across the board. These processors help the EOS 7D Mark II capture up to 1090 JPEG/LARGE, 31 RAW, and 19 RAW+JPEG shots in a single burst for amazing action photography. They also enable the camera’s powerful image processing on-the-fly: lens aberration, variances in peripheral illumination, and image distortion can all be corrected in real time with the Dual DIGIC 6 Image Processors.

    Extensive ISO Range
    Optimized for low-light shooting, the EOS 7D Mark II’s sensor captures images at up to ISO 16000 (expandable to H1: 25600 and H2: 51200). This is because of an improved higher sensitivity photodiode construction, CMOS circuitry, and color filters with higher light transmittance. As a result, the EOS 7D Mark II records both still and moving images at higher ISO speeds with remarkably low noise, making excellent low-light photography and moviemaking possible.

    EOS iSA System
    The EOS 7D Mark II has an Intelligent Subject Analysis (iSA system that employs an independant RGB+IR light sensor with approximately 150,000-pixel resolution. With this new sensor, not only does the camera have a finer level of accuracy, but when combined with iTR AF - which offers a new processing algorithm to detect faces, bodies and colors - the EOS 7D Mark II can track subjects with a significantly greater level of success. The RGB+IR sensor even enables infrared-light detection and a flicker detection system that compensates for flickering light sources, taking shots only at peak light volume.

    Full HD 60p Video Recording
    The EOS 7D Mark II delivers refined and detailed EOS movie image quality with Full HD 60p (59.94 fps NTSC), and 50.00 fps (PAL), recording at ISO values up to 16000 (Dual Pixel CMOS AF is not available when shooting at 60p). At these frame rates, even a fast-moving subject looks smooth in HD, as does a slow motion playback.

    Multiple Input / Output Options
    Shoot Full HD and send uncompressed NTSC, PAL and 24p footage out directly using the EOS 7D Mark II’s included HDMI port. HDMI output makes it possible to monitor images on a large display or save image data to an external recorder. Thanks to an audio output function, video and sound can be recorded together to a single recorder. The EOS 7D Mark II also has dedicated microphone and headphone jacks for professional sound recording and monitoring. Dual card slots for CF and SD cards are also included, offering many options and long recording times with automatic switching between recording media.
